1 |
On Sat, Feb 13, 2021 at 12:26:51PM +0100, Toralf Förster wrote: |
2 |
> On 2/13/21 12:16 PM, Alessandro Barbieri wrote: |
3 |
> > |
4 |
> > IMO manpages should be installed unconditionally and the useflag dropped |
5 |
> I'd like to disagree - IIRC there're packages with a ridiculous large |
6 |
> and expensive dep tree just to build their man pages. |
7 |
> |
8 |
It "would" be fine if maintainers were all willing to pre-build man |
9 |
pages and distribute them where relevant. |
10 |
|
11 |
There was a previous attempt[1] to make this a policy but it didn't |
12 |
work out. So now everyone is doing what they prefer, including using |
13 |
USE=man or unconditionally pulling deps just for man pages. |
14 |
|
15 |
If maintainers don't all want to do this for every packages, then I |
16 |
think USE=man needs to stay and go global, lot of users even get |
17 |
angered by not-so-heavy sphinx being pulled only for man pages they |
18 |
never read. |
19 |
|
20 |
[1] https://archives.gentoo.org/gentoo-dev/message/a6a8e840773da77ee6008ac23b4f89e1 |
21 |
-- |
22 |
ionen |